What the leadership shake up and guidance update mean for Perrigo stock
Perrigo (PRGO) just combined a sudden leadership change with a reaffirmed 2026 earnings outlook, after CEO and President Patrick Lockwood-Taylor resigned over personal conduct issues unrelated to the company’s business or financials.
The Board has moved quickly by naming existing director Albert A. Manzone as Interim CEO and President and launching a search for a permanent successor. This signals an effort to keep the business on its existing course.
Perrigo’s recent executive change and reaffirmed 2026 earnings outlook come after a mixed price picture, with the 90 day share price return of 13.07% contrasting with a year to date decline of 20.88% and a 1 year total shareholder return decline of 55.24%. This suggests that recent momentum is improving, but long term holders have seen heavy value erosion.

Most Popular Narrative: 33.4% Undervalued
Against a last close of $10.99, the most followed narrative pegs Perrigo’s fair value at $16.50, framing a sizeable valuation gap to interrogate.
Increasing consumer cost-consciousness is driving stronger adoption of store-brand (private label) OTC products, with Perrigo reporting accelerated unit and volume share gains; this structural shift is expanding Perrigo's addressable market and supports enduring top-line revenue growth.
Want to see what sits behind that valuation gap? The narrative leans on steadier revenues, rising margins and a future earnings multiple usually reserved for faster growing companies. This raises the question of how those moving parts combine into a single fair value line.
Result: Fair Value of $16.50 (UNDERVALUED)
However, this hinges on infant nutrition and OTC execution. Softer category demand and intense price competition could quickly erode the upside case.
